Description

In this handbook, drug monographs are alphabetically organized and cross-referenced by brand and generic name. Each drug monograph includes up to 41 fields of information, with dental-specific content highlighted in red. Fields of interest include:

Local Anesthetic/Vasoconstrictor Precautions
Effects on Dental Treatment
Effects on Bleeding
Dental Comment

Special sections dedicated to the medically-compromised patient, specific oral conditions, and sample prescriptions are included. Lexicomp’s Drug Information Handbook for Dentistry is excellent for chair-side use, supporting safe pharmacotherapy and improved patient care.
